THE VILLA

A stunning newly built villa with private beach access, sea views and luxury facilities.

Villa Glyfa has luxury amenities, open-plan living and stunning sea views with private beach access. Each of the 3 double bedrooms features an en-suite bathroom and stunning sea views. The swimming pool and outdoor dining area is secluded and completely private with beautifully manicured gardens.

For 2025, the lower level will have a new massage room and gym.

Corfu is one of Greece’s greenest islands, so there is a mix of rain and glorious sunshine. The warmest months of the year are July and August, approximately 31°C. May and June are very pleasant with temperatures ranging from 23 to 28°C and the sea is usually warm enough to swim in by June, and the average rainfall decreases at the end of May. Equally, September and October are a great time to go with cooler temperatures, perfect for walks, runs or hiking.
